2006 Subaru Legacy IV (facelift 2006) 2.5i GT (250 Hp) AWD | Specifications


Engine specs

Compression ratio 8.2
Coolant 7.2 l
Cylinder Bore 99.5 mm
Engine Model/Code EJ255
Engine aspiration Turbocharger, Intercooler
Engine configuration Boxer
Engine displacement 2457 cm3
Engine layout Front, Longitudinal
Engine oil capacity 4 l
Fuel injection system Multi-point indirect injection
Number of cylinders 4
Number of valves per cylinder 4
Piston Stroke 79 mm
Power 250 Hp @ 6000 rpm.
Power per litre 101.8 Hp/l
Torque 339 Nm @ 3600 rpm.
Valvetrain DOHC

Drivetrain, brakes and suspension specs

Assisting systems ABS (Anti-lock braking system)
Drive wheel All wheel drive (4x4)
Front brakes Ventilated discs
Front suspension Spring Strut
Number of gears and type of gearbox 5 gears, manual transmission
Power steering Hydraulic Steering
Rear brakes Disc
Rear suspension Coil spring
Steering type Steering rack and pinion
Tires size 215/45 R17
Wheel rims size 7.0J x 17

Space, Volume and weights

Fuel tank capacity 64 l
Kerb Weight 1497 kg
Max load 533 kg
Max. weight 2030 kg
Trunk (boot) space - minimum 433 l

Performance specs

Fuel Type Petrol (Gasoline)
Fuel consumption (economy) - extra urban 9.4 l/100 km
Fuel consumption (economy) - urban 12.4 l/100 km
Weight-to-power ratio 6 kg/Hp, 167 Hp/tonne
Weight-to-torque ratio 4.4 kg/Nm, 226.5 Nm/tonne

Dimensions

Front track 1495 mm
Height 1425 mm
Length 4730 mm
Minimum turning circle (turning diameter) 11.6 m
Rear (Back) track 1485 mm
Ride height (ground clearance) 150 mm
Wheelbase 2670 mm
Width 1730 mm

General information

Body type Sedan
Brand Subaru
Doors 4
End of production 2009 year
Generation Legacy IV (facelift 2006)
Model Legacy
Modification (Engine) 2.5i GT (250 Hp) AWD
Powertrain Architecture Internal Combustion engine
Seats 5
Start of production 2006 year

The VIN number, also known as the VIN code, is the vehicle identification number. VIN is an abbreviation of the English term Vehicle Identification Number. The VIN number is a unique set of 17 characters that car manufacturers assign to all vehicles they produce. The VIN code can be found on various parts of the car body or in the registration documents.
